Farmahin
Town
Farmahin is a city in the Central District of Farahan County, Markazi province, Iran, serving as capital of both the county and the district. It is also the administrative center for Farmahin Rural District.

Borzabad, Markazi
Village
Borzabad is a village in Farmahin Rural District, in the Central District of Farahan County, Markazi Province, Iran. The 2006 Iranian census found the population of the village was 185, made up of 71 families. Borzabad, Markazi is situated 5 km north of رستوران سنتی کوثر.
